Overview

The MAX8069ESA+ from Maxim Integrated is a 1.2V temperature-compensated bandgap voltage reference IC designed for precision analog signal conditioning in low-power systems. It delivers 25ppm/°C max temperature coefficient, 0.6Ω typical reverse dynamic impedance, and operates with reverse current as low as 60µA. It serves as a stable reference in ADC/DAC circuits, threshold detectors, and portable instrumentation.

Technical Context

The MAX8069ESA+ implements a two-terminal bandgap reference architecture optimized for stability under low reverse current (60µA–5mA), eliminating need for external biasing circuitry. Its internal design ensures freedom from oscillation even with up to 200pF of stray capacitance-provided a 4.7µF shunt capacitor is used per datasheet Note 2.

Unlike standard Zener references, it maintains tight output voltage regulation (1.20V–1.25V at 500µA) across temperature and load, with minimal dynamic impedance (0.6Ω typ) and low RMS noise (20µV, 10Hz–10kHz). It functions exclusively in reverse-biased mode, with cathode as output and anode as ground reference terminal.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Output Voltage1.22V typical at 500µA reverse current; enables precise 1.2V system-level calibration without trimming.
Tempco (max)25ppm/°C over –40°C to +85°C; ensures ≤±3mV drift across full industrial temperature range.
Reverse Current Range60µA to 5mA; supports ultra-low-power sensor interfaces and battery-operated DPMs.
Dynamic Impedance0.6Ω typical at 500µA; minimizes load-induced voltage sag during fast transient current demands.
RMS Noise20µV (10Hz–10kHz); preserves SNR in 12-bit+ ADC reference paths without additional filtering.
Forward Voltage Drop0.6V at 500µA; defines safe forward-bias limit-device must operate in reverse mode only.

Pinout & Package

MAX8069ESA+ is housed in an 8-pin SOIC (SO-8, package code S8-2), with pins 1 and 2 unconnected (N.C.), pin 3 as anode (ground reference), and pin 4 as cathode (1.2V output). Pins 5–8 are N.C. No internal connections exist to pins 1, 2, 5, 6, 7, or 8.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
Pin 1No ConnectInternally floating; must remain unconnected on PCB.
Pin 2No ConnectInternally floating; no routing or grounding required.
Pin 3AnodeGround reference node; connects to system GND for reverse-bias operation.
Pin 4Cathode1.2V output terminal; supplies reference voltage to ADC REF+, DAC VREF, or comparator inputs.
Pins 5–8No ConnectAll internally open; left unconnected per datasheet top-view diagram.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ar voltage reference appl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
MAX6126AASA+1.2V output, 3ppm/°C max tempco, 10µA min supply current, SO-8 package.Higher precision and lower noise (12µV RMS), but cost premium and tighter layout sensitivity.Select when <5ppm total error budget requires sub-10ppm/°C drift and ultra-low noise.
TLV431AIDBVRAdjustable 1.24V reference, 100ppm/°C max tempco, 80µA min cathode current, SOT-23-5.Lower cost and smaller footprint, but higher tempco limits use to commercial-temp consumer devices.Select for cost-sensitive portable instruments where 0°C to +70°C operation suffices and ±10mV drift is acceptable.

Compared with MAX6126AASA+, the MAX8069ESA+ trades precision for wider industrial temperature support and lower minimum operating current; versus TLV431AIDBVR, it offers superior tempco and noise performance at the expense of adjustability and package size.

FAQ

What is the operating mode of the MAX8069ESA+?

The MAX8069ESA+ operates exclusively in reverse-bias mode: the cathode (pin 4) is the 1.2V output terminal, and the anode (pin 3) connects to system ground. Forward biasing (anode positive relative to cathode) must be avoided, as forward voltage drop is specified only for fault condition analysis-not functional operation. The MAX8069ESA+ is not a diode; it is a two-terminal bandgap reference IC requiring correct polarity to deliver regulated voltage.

Can the MAX8069ESA+ replace the ICL8069 in existing designs?

Yes-the MAX8069ESA+ is explicitly stated as a functional alternative to the ICL8069 with identical pinout and compatible electrical behavior. Both share the same SO-8 footprint, terminal assignments (anode = pin 3, cathode = pin 4), and 1.2V nominal output. No PCB changes are required when substituting MAX8069ESA+ for ICL8069 in legacy designs, provided temperature range requirements align (MAX8069ESA+ supports –40°C to +85°C vs. ICL8069's 0°C to +70°C).

What is the minimum reverse current needed for stable operation of the MAX8069ESA+?

The MAX8069ESA+ guarantees specification compliance down to 60µA reverse current, making it suitable for ultra-low-power applications such as battery-backed DPMs and energy-harvesting sensor nodes. Below 60µA, output voltage may deviate beyond the 1.20V–1.25V range and tempco may exceed 25ppm/°C. The MAX8069ESA+ datasheet specifies all key parameters-including noise, impedance, and tempco-at IR = 500µA, but confirms functional stability begins at 60µA.

Does the MAX8069ESA+ require an external capacitor for stability?

A 4.7µF shunt capacitor is recommended at the cathode (pin 4) if stray capacitance exceeds 200pF, per datasheet Note 2. This ensures stability under all operating conditions, especially in high-density PCBs or long trace runs. Without this capacitor, oscillation may occur above 200pF; with it, the MAX8069ESA+ remains stable across its full reverse current range (60µA–5mA) and temperature range (–40°C to +85°C). The capacitor is not required for basic functionality at low-stray layouts.

How does the MAX8069ESA+ compare to Zener-based references in low-current applications?

The MAX8069ESA+ outperforms traditional Zener references below 100µA due to its bandgap architecture: it maintains 25ppm/°C tempco and 0.6Ω dynamic impedance even at 60µA, whereas Zeners exhibit steeply rising tempco and impedance below 200µA. Zener references also typically require higher bias currents (>1mA) for stable regulation. The MAX8069ESA+ thus enables precision referencing in micropower systems where Zeners would drift excessively or fail to regulate-making it the preferred choice for modern low-IQ sensor interfaces.
